问题标签 [arduino-ultra-sonic]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
arduino - 如何使用arduino阻止LED在距离以上点亮?
仅当距离低于 7 英尺(213 厘米)时,如何点亮 Arduino 上的 LED?当我运行程序时,即使物体离开它,LED 也会保持亮起。
这是我的 Arduino 设计: https ://www.tinkercad.com/things/hWjCeMzBFMG-swanky-habbi
这是我的代码:
我是 Arduino 的新手,任何帮助将不胜感激。
arduino - 如何与 HM-19 BLE 模块通信并使用超声波传感器进行扫描
我正在为学校做我的高级项目,我需要做的一部分是使用 HM-19 蓝牙 5.0 模块连接到另一个蓝牙 5.0 模块并建立主从连接。
我可以做到这一点,但是当我包含超声波传感器进行扫描所需的代码时,我对 HM-19 的命令不会返回任何内容,并且我无法执行任何基本功能,例如查找连接。我已经在使用和不使用超声波传感器代码的情况下对其进行了测试,当我使用代码的传感器部分时会出现问题。
明确一点,我要做的只是让我的蓝牙 5.0 芯片连接到另一个芯片并执行正常命令,同时当我把手放在前面时,还向我的串行监视器输入一段距离。这只是一个测试,一旦完成,我将转向我真正想做的事情。
这只是项目的起点。我在 void 循环中对我的传感器和蓝牙芯片进行了函数调用,这就是其中的全部内容。
我只想知道如何解决这个问题。如何使用超声波传感器进行扫描并向蓝牙模块发送命令?任何帮助将不胜感激。
[这里是评论传感器时的结果][1] 和 [这里是导致无限循环的不成功结果,我无法到达返回芯片所说内容的代码部分][2]。最后,虽然大部分链接都包含 HM-10 的内容,但 HM-19 的命令基本相同。我正在添加更多内容,因为堆栈溢出不会让我编辑这篇文章,直到有更多字符或其他东西。我希望你有一个美好的一天/晚上的人阅读这篇文章。
这是我的代码:
arduino-esp8266 - 带有超声波传感器的 Blynk 通知
这是我的代码,它在距离大于 150 时实际发送 blynk 通知。但它的输出非常奇怪。它一次又一次地运行设置功能,而不是只运行一次。由于此代码,esp8266 设备上线和下线,然后再次上线。你能告诉我为什么它一次又一次地运行设置函数以及为什么它打印堆栈......<<在输出而不是serial.print()函数。我不知道为什么?我是布林克的新手。
代码的输出如下所示:
.......它会一次又一次地继续打印。任何帮助将不胜感激。
python - 我用 python 控制 Sonor 传感器(超声波传感器)的代码不起作用
我想用 python 控制我在 arduino uno 板上的超声波传感器,但我收到一个错误,说 async 和 zerojson 文件无效。
我尝试安装以下文件,但异步与我的 pycharm 版本不兼容,因此错误仍然存在。我能做些什么?
我的代码如下:
io - 如何为 ESP8266 选择合适的 I/O 扩展器
我有一个 ESP8266,我想连接几个超声波传感器。我需要每秒轮询一次以计算他们测量的距离。因为 ESP8266 没有很多数字引脚,所以我必须使用 I/O 扩展器,但我不知道如何找到便宜的选择。每个 HC-SR04 传感器我需要 1 个 IN 引脚和 1 个 OUT 引脚,我计划使用尽可能多的传感器。有谁能够帮我?
arduino - 超声波传感器
现在我正在使用 2 个超声波传感器,但我发现它们在户外变得不稳定并给出随机读数.....虽然它们在房间内正常运行......我该如何解决这个问题???那是代码,似乎关闭的传感器总是在读取,我检查了接线,它很好,所以我真的不知道问题出在哪里??
python - 使用 HC-SR04 超声波传感器无法找到距离
我正在尝试使用 HC SR04 超声波传感器找到与附近物体的距离。我按照以下链接中的教程进行操作:
HC-SR04 Raspberry Pi 上的超声波测距传感器
我按照给定的方式复制了所有说明。我在尝试运行代码时遇到了问题。
该代码似乎没有进入第一个 while 循环,其中正在检查 ECHO 引脚的低信号。这给我计算距离带来了问题。上述代码的输出如下:
谁能指出问题可能是什么?
python - 即使在中断后程序循环
这是代码:
问题出在 y==2 循环上。由于某种原因,它不断重复自己,即使 y=None。任何人都知道如何解决这个问题,我整天都在研究它。谢谢!